I think that really depends what strain your growing. In fact, till I grew some Mephisto plants, I'd never seeb ine flower in less than 25 days. My White widow goes 30-35. And a little longer in veg should give a bigger plant so what's not to like?

well i just think the purpose for autos would be shorter grow period. I think if i have a ww photo seed and a ww auto seed, and they both take the same amount of growth time, i would choose the photo because it would be cheaper to run 12/12 light instead of the extra 6-12 hrs a day.

Well, if you switch to 12/12, you'll need to leave it there if it turns out to be a photo period. I've moved autos in and out of 12/12 environments and into 18/6 with no issues. And I'm running a few autos in with a photo right now, thats on 12/12. I expect my autos won't gain their full size but after this they have their own grow space.
